commit-graph: pass graphs that are to be merged as parameter
When determining whether or not we want to merge a commit graph chain we retrieve the graph that is to be merged via the context's repository. With an upcoming change though it will become a bit more complex to figure out the commit graph, which would lead to code duplication. Prepare for this change by passing the graph that is to be merged as a parameter. Signed-off-by: Patrick Steinhardt <ps@pks.im> Signed-off-by: Junio C Hamano <gitster@pobox.com>
